Patent number: 12268294Abstract: An oral care system that includes an oral care implement and a tracking attachment. The oral care implement may include a handle and a head. The tracking attachment is detachably coupled to the oral care implement. The tracking attachment may include an outer casing having an outer surface and a connection element that is configured to mate with a connection element on a handle of the powered oral care implement to couple the outer casing to the handle. The tracking attachment may further include a plurality of visual markers protruding from the outer surface of the outer casing.Type: GrantFiled: September 13, 2023Date of Patent: April 8, 2025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: John Gatzemeyer, Takahide Okai

Patent number: 12161520Abstract: An oral care apparatus that includes an oral care implement and a tracking module detachably coupled to the oral care implement. The oral care implement includes a body having an inner surface that defines an internal cavity. The tracking module may be coupled to the oral care implement by inserting a portion of the tracking module into the internal cavity of the body. The tracking module includes a coupling portion and an electronics portion that are coupled together so as to be fixed together in the axial direction but freely rotatable relative to one another. The tracking module may only be able to be inserted into the internal cavity of the body in a single orientation. Furthermore, when in the internal cavity, the electronics portion of the tracking module may be non-rotatable relative to the body while the coupling portion of the tracking module remains rotatable relative to the body.Type: GrantFiled: September 13, 2021Date of Patent: December 10, 2024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: Takahide Okai, Thuan Chong Tan, Mickael Norbert Bouffaut

Patent number: 12108870Abstract: An oral care refill head and an oral care kit comprising the same. The oral care refill head may include a sleeve portion, a head portion, and an elastomeric prophy cup. The sleeve portion may have an inner surface that defines an internal cavity for receiving a portion of a stem of an oral care implement handle therein so that the oral care refill head can be repetitively attached to and detached from the oral care implement handle. The elastomeric prophy cup may comprise an outer surface that forms at least a portion of a peripheral side surface of the head portion. The elastomeric prophy cup may be formed by injection molding an elastomeric material onto a support portion of the head portion. The oral care refill head may be packaged together with a store of an anti-sensitivity oral care material to form a kit.Type: GrantFiled: May 7, 2021Date of Patent: October 8, 2024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: Brian Bloch, Takahide Okai, John Gatzemeyer

Patent number: 11877643Abstract: A tracking attachment for an oral care implement that includes a housing and a tracking unit configured to track position, orientation, or movement of the oral care implement. The housing may define a receiving cavity that is configured to receive a portion of the oral care implement. The housing may include a first housing portion having an inner surface that defines a first portion of the receiving cavity that is open at both of the first and second ends of the first housing portion and a second housing portion that mates with the first housing portion to detachably couple the second housing portion to the first housing portion. The second housing portion may have an inner surface that defines a second portion of the receiving cavity that is open at the second end of the second housing portion.Type: GrantFiled: November 15, 2022Date of Patent: January 23, 2024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: Wu Yang, Takahide Okai

Patent number: 11833004Abstract: An oral care implement handle or a refill head therefor. The refill head may include a sleeve portion extending from a proximal end to a distal end, the sleeve portion having an inner surface that defines an internal cavity. The internal cavity may extend along a sleeve axis from an open bottom end at the proximal end of the sleeve portion to a closed top end, the internal cavity being configured to receive an attachment portion of a stem of an oral care implement handle. The internal cavity may have a proximal section adjacent the open bottom end and a distal section adjacent the closed top end. The distal section of the internal cavity may include a central portion located on the sleeve axis and at least one slot portion radially extending from the central portion.Type: GrantFiled: June 3, 2020Date of Patent: December 5, 2023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: Brian Bloch, Takahide Okai, John Gatzemeyer

Patent number: 11771214Abstract: An oral care system that includes an oral care implement and a tracking attachment. The oral care implement may include a handle and a head. The tracking attachment is detachably coupled to the oral care implement. The tracking attachment may include a first component comprising a first housing having an inner surface that defines a first cavity and a second component comprising a second housing having an inner surface that defines a second cavity. When the tracking attachment is coupled to the oral care implement, a first portion of the handle is positioned within the first cavity and a second portion of the handle is positioned within the second cavity.Type: GrantFiled: March 9, 2022Date of Patent: October 3, 2023Assignee: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: John Gatzemeyer, Takahide Okai

Publication number: 20230189977Abstract: An oral care device having a head with cleaning elements and a handle coupled to the head. The handle may include a selectively rotatable ring arranged between the head and a distal end of the handle that is configured to allow a user to select a desired mode of operation of the oral care device. The handle may include a selectively illuminated light that is configured to display at least one color that visually indicates that certain behaviors, patterns, and/or consistent habits have been performed successfully. The handle may include a processor configured to track a duration of a user's brushing session, a light ring on a bottom surface of the handle, and a pressure sensor. Respective portions of the light ring may be selectively illuminated by the processor to visualize progress toward achieving a predetermined brushing routine time and/or to visualize an over-pressure condition sensed by the pressure sensor.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 29, 2022Publication date: June 22, 2023Applicant: Colgate-Palmolive CompanyInventors: Brian Bloch, Takahide Okai, Geoffrey Baldwin, Danielle Denis, Kimberly Curtis
